单词 necropolis
释义 necropolis|nɛˈkrɒpəʊlɪs|
Also nekro-.
[a. Gr. νεκρόπολις city of the dead, cemetery, f. νεκρός corpse + πόλις city.]
A cemetery; freq. used as the name of large cemeteries in or near cities.
1819Southey in Q. Rev. XXI. 381 To rid the city of its burial places, and establish a necropolis without the walls.1831J. Strang Necropolis Glasguensis Pref. 6 Argument for the establishment in this neighbourhood of a Necropolis.1870–4J. Thomson City Dreadf. Nt. i. viii, In some necropolis you find Perchance one mourner to a thousand dead.
fig.1831Carlyle Sart. Res. iii. vii, How shall we domesticate ourselves in this spectral Necropolis, or rather City both of the Dead and of the Unborn?
attrib.1854Card. Wiseman Fabiola ii. i, It was not a cemetery or necropolis company.., but rather a pious and recognised confraternity.
b. An old or prehistoric burying-place.
1850Grote Greece ii. lix. (1862) V. 213 Extensive catacombs yet remain to mark the length of time during which this ancient Nekropolis served its purpose.1874Green Short Hist. i. §1. 9 Hill and hill-slope were the necropolis of a vanished race.
c. pl. in various forms.
Necropoles may possibly be intended as pl. of necropole, after F. nécropole; there is, however, no example of such a form in the singular.
1864Chambers's Encycl. VI. 695 The most remarkable necropolises are that of Thebes, [etc.].1874M. E. Herbert tr. Hübner's Ramble ii. vii. (1878) 380 Save these two necropoli, I have seen all the most celebrated monuments of Japan.1885Century Mag. XXXI. 2 The necropoleis of Lycian Myra.1885Pall Mall G. 13 June 4/2 Mr. Richter's researches into the early necropoles of Cyprus.
Hence necroˈpolitan a., of or belonging to a necropolis.
1892Spectator 23 Jan. 115 That singular necropolitan peerage, the death-list of the Times.1914C. Mackenzie Sinister St. II. iv. v. 965 Always in contrast with these necropolitan streets, these masks of human dwellings, were Michael's own thoughts thronged with fancies of himself and Lily.1916A. Huxley Burning Wheel 48 The necropolitan ground.1931A. Gibbs New Crusade 78 The long arm of coincidence was in his case the long arm of the law, white sleeved, and it was raised against the further progress of her vehicle to allow a large necropolitan car to come swinging serenely from the Embankment to the left over Westminster Bridge.1960Times Lit. Suppl. 20 May p. xi/2 The curiously necropolitan conventions of the worst comic strips.
